PM Shehbaz hails Trump as ‘saviour of South Asia’

0

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if praised Donald Trump for his efforts to help secure peace in South Asia and the Middle East, describing the US president as a “saviour of South Asia” and a “man of peace”.

“Your great diplomacy has surely brought calm to many international, serious hotspots. Your timely and very effective intervention to achieve ceasefire between India and Pakistan potentially averted loss of tens of millions of people,” he said while addressing the inaugural session of the “Board of Peace” in Washington.

“You have truly proved to be a man of peace. And let me say, Mr. President, you are truly saviour of South Asia,” he remarked.

PM Shehbaz said the international community must work together towards a credible pathway to Palestinian self-determination through the establishment of an independent, sovereign, and contiguous state of Palestine,

He expressed hope that under the visionary and dynamic leadership of US President Donald Trump, the international community will ensure a just and lasting resolution to the issue of Palestine.

Highlighting the efforts of President Trump for global peace, he said, “It’s a great honour, Mr President, to attend this inaugural Board of Peace meeting in this holy month of Ramazan and may God reward you and make you successful in your efforts to bring lasting peace in Gaza.”

“Mr President, we deeply appreciate your unique initiative and your dynamic leadership in advancing peaceful solutions to conflicts across the globe,” he continued.

He said, “The bold diplomacy of President Trump has surely brought calm to many international serious hot spots.”

“And today is a day which will mark a place in the annals of history, that through your efforts, through your untiring support and great efforts, long-lasting peace in Gaza will be achieved. It will be your legacy for all time to come,” he added.

The prime minister said, “The people of Palestine have long endured illegal occupation and immense suffering. And to achieve long-lasting peace, it is very important that ceasefire violations must end to preserve lives and advance reconstruction efforts.”

“The people of Palestine must exercise full control of their land and their future in line with UN Security Council resolutions,” he stressed.
